Defective broomcorn [Sorghum bicolor (L.) Moench] panicle in relation to vegetative space per plant

Field trial was set up in Šajkaš in 2002 and 2003 to estimate influence of vegetative space per plant on formation of defective broomcorn panicle (spike, crooked, wrinkled). Experiment included two commercial broomcorn varieties (Neoplanta plus and Prima), two row widths (50 and 70 cm) and six different distances among plants in row (5, 9, 13, 17, 21 and 25 cm). All trial variants included certain percentage of defective panicles formed under the influence of vegetative space per plant and agroclimatic conditions. Spike panicles generally appeared in high density and crooked panicles in low density crop. Lowest percentage of defective panicles appeared in crop with 100,000-120,000 plants per hectare. Considering yield, optimum broomcorn planting recommendation is 150,000-160,000 plants per hectare, with 50 cm between rows and 13 cm between plants, or 70 cm between rows and 9 cm between plants in a row.
